160 A continuous, flat across the thermal range
The Siemens 3VA2216-5MN32-0HA0 is a SENTRON molded case circuit breaker (MCCB) rated for motor protection duty. It carries 160 A continuously from 40 °C through 70 °C ambient — no derating needed across that span, which simplifies panel design in a warm enclosure. Interrupting capacity is 187 kA at 240 V, 121 kA at 415 V and 440 V, 75.6 kA at 500 V, and 4.5 kA at 690 V. That 187 kA figure at 240 V is the headline — it handles high available fault current on the secondary side of a distribution transformer without cascading upstream. The 3-pole unit is designed specifically for motor protection, with phase failure detection built in. It ships with a shunt trip (STL) auxiliary release; no auxiliary switch is fitted on this variant.
Footprint and panel fit
Dimensions are 105 mm wide × 181 mm high × 86 mm deep. That width is the standard 3-pole MCCB footprint for the SENTRON 3VA2 frame — it lands on a DIN rail or mounts directly to a backplate. The 86 mm depth leaves clearance for wiring gutters in a 200 mm deep enclosure. Maximum power loss is 19.7 W. That figure drives the thermal rise inside the panel; if you're packing multiple breakers in a sealed cabinet, factor it into the ventilation or forced-air calculation.
Operating environment and storage
Rated for operation from -25 °C to 70 °C ambient. Storage range is -40 °C to 80 °C — that wider storage window covers unheated warehouses and shipping containers. The trip indicator is not fitted on this variant; undervoltage release is also absent.
